What is Cosmetic Acupuncture ?

Cosmetic Acupuncture is a method of restoring a vibrant glow to the face and hence helps you look your best. It improves skin firmness whilst softening wrinkles and fine lines. It helps skin tone attain a more youthful radiance. Eyes become ‘brighter’ and look less tired. In addition, there are wider benefits with acupuncture – such as an improved sleep pattern, internal vigour and a general sense of calm.

There are a variety of options to counteract ageing, but for those who prefer a more natural approach to fighting the signs of ageing, cosmetic acupuncture is becoming an increasingly popular choice. As cosmetic acupuncture is not as dramatic as its more invasive counterparts (surgery, fillers, Botox) the results are much more natural. This is because no one feature is singled out for improvement – the whole face is addressed and hence the whole face benefits from a subtle yet effective boost and the effect never looks overdone.

The philosophy of cosmetic acupuncture incorporates a whole body approach. According to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M), our external appearance reflects our internal health. Therefore a balanced internal ‘self’ will extend to our external physical appearance and one exudes a natural healthy glow.

Cosmetic acupuncture is completely holistic so it revitalises you on the outside and balances your internal health. This leads to a greater feeling of well-being and vibrant skin rejuvenation.
